Rubber Roof Installation Questions
What is a rubber roof? A rubber roof is a durable, flexible roofing material made from synthetic rubber, ideal for flat or low-slope roofs on residential and commercial properties.
What types of projects are suitable for rubber roof installation? Rubber roofing is commonly used for new flat roofs, roof replacements, or repairs on garages, sheds, and commercial buildings.
How long does a rubber roof typ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, rubber roofs can last around 20 to 30 years.
What should property owners consider before installing a rubber roof? It’s important to assess the roof’s condition, ensure proper drainage, and choose the right type of rubber membrane for the specific project.
